Book : Programming Models for Distributed Computation

14 views
Skip to first unread message

Nitin Bhide

unread,
Mar 29, 2020, 10:53:33 AM3/29/20
to nitinsknow...@googlegroups.com
https://github.com/heathermiller/dist-prog-book  

From the introduction

Source repo for the book that I and my students in my course at Northeastern University, CS7680 Special Topics in Computing Systems: Programming Models for Distributed Computing, are writing on the topic of programming models for distributed systems.
This is a book about the programming constructs we use to build distributed systems. These range from the small, RPC, futures, actors, to the large; systems built up of these components like MapReduce and Spark. We explore issues and concerns central to distributed systems like consistency, availability, and fault tolerance, from the lens of the programming models and frameworks that the programmer uses to build these systems.

Covers concepts like
1. RPC
2. Futures and Promises
3. Message Passing. 

Manish Kumar

unread,
Apr 11, 2020, 11:50:58 AM4/11/20
to nitinsknow...@googlegroups.com
Adding to topics listed by Nitin. One interesting topic listed is Actors, its very beautiful and powerful tool.
To give idea about its usage, Whatsapp(Erlang), LinkedIn, Tesla Virtual power Plant(both Akka Actors, JVM).




--
You received this message because you are subscribed to the Google Groups "nitinsknowledgeshare" group.
To unsubscribe from this group and stop receiving emails from it, send an email to nitinsknowledges...@googlegroups.com.
To view this discussion on the web visit https://groups.google.com/d/msgid/nitinsknowledgeshare/CAAtxCFQAx2E4ZRuF4kTML%2B_vDBtS41pe5iyYn-1jbEn5VYDWDw%40mail.gmail.com.
Reply all
Reply to author
Forward
0 new messages